you can do both in ableton dude, use it for live purposes
you can also use it for production, and relitivly easy to use
you can record samples from records loop it, warp (time strech) to your tempo
Personally i use Ableton as the host with a bunch of plugins such as Native Instruments Massive also use reason 4.0 also as it slaves to ableton using rewire. Reasons a little more difficult to get your head around but stick with it!
Grab the demos of both
